Ancestors who could identify healthy mates were at a
substantial reproductive advantage. Of course, immune function cannot be
observed directly. Rather, good-genes sexual selection hypothesis proposes that
individuals rely on morphological cues to inform a potential mate's
immunocompetence (Sugiyama, 2005). In turn, organisms might compete for mates
by advertising their 'good genes' via traits that are immunologically-costly to
produce (Zahavi, 1975). This immunocompetence handicap hypothesis (ICHH) is one
of the most cited hypotheses in all of evolutionary biology. Yet
disconcertingly, empirical evidence supporting a link between secondary sex characteristics and immune
function is weak (Hamilton especially among humans. The proposed program of research addresses
this fundamental gap in knowledge by systematically assessing: 1) whether putative costly-to-develop secondary sex characteristics (e.g., male vocal and facial masculinity; height)
do indeed indicate underlying immunocompetence at either the genetic
(major histocompatability) or functional (innate and adaptive immunity) levels, 2) whether uniquely female secondary sexual traits (vocal and facial
femininity, breast size and shape) inform immunocompetence, fertility, or both, 3)
whether immune function pre-puberty predicts sex hormone-mediated development of secondary sex traits, whether parental secondary sexual characteristics actually predict offspring
immunocompetence, and 4) whether female perceptions of male attractiveness inform their underlying immunocompetence.
Together, this ambitious yet high-feasibility program will provide the first comprehensive examination of diverse multi-level markers of immune function in relation to prominent human secondary sexual characteristics. It will be the first large-scale test of the ICHH in humans. Evidence from these studies will transform the field's understanding of sexual selection in humans by either supporting or calling into question one of the most widely-cited, yet poorly evidenced, hypotheses in contemporary evolutionary theory.
